Transaction ec8ae476cf5683da8c9ee40916994964f3c049ac000d00c5e995ccabc9097d9a
1 Input
1 Output
-
ec8ae476cf5683da8c9ee40916994964f3c049ac000d00c5e995ccabc9097d9a:0
- value
- 1113556
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e71d99894bce96b95cf0d8c3e79d8622cf2d9fb OP_EQUAL
- address
- 3QtPwhoT1LpQBfkgZJCLy8gc7tqC5uTjqv